Review the Religious Education curriculum in all schools to ensure all major religions are taught with equal depth and respect. I believe Christianity should still be taught, but religions like Sikhism, Hinduism, Islam, Judaism and Buddhism should receive more meaningful and balanced coverage.
I feel many students only learn surface-level information about religions outside Christianity, which can lead to stereotypes and misunderstanding. As a Sikh, I feel the teaching of other religions in schools are often reduced to festivals or basics instead of their history, beliefs and contributions.
